• 제목/요약/키워드: 블록체인 시스템

검색결과 469건 처리시간 0.029초

블록체인 기반 오프체인 동영상 스트리밍 시스템 (Off-chain Video Streaming System based on Blockchain)

  • 정민혁;김상균
    • 한국방송∙미디어공학회:학술대회논문집
    • /
    • 한국방송∙미디어공학회 2020년도 하계학술대회
    • /
    • pp.535-536
    • /
    • 2020
  • 블록체인의 특성 중 하나인 합의 과정으로 인해 블록체인 상 거래속도는 일반적인 온라인 거래보다 느리다는 단점이 있다. 분산형 어플리케이션 서비스들은 이러한 블록체인의 느린 거래속도와 확장성을 오프체인 트랜잭션으로 해결한다. 오프체인 트랜잭션이란 블록체인 외부에서 거래를 실행하여 이루어진 거래들의 내역을 주기적으로 블록체인에 기록하는 방식이다. 오프체인 트랜잭션을 활용하면 기존의 블록체인 거래방식보다 더 다양한 구조로 시스템을 설계할 수 있다. 본 논문에서는 이러한 오프체인 트랜잭션의 장점을 활용한 실시간 비디오 스트리밍 시스템을 제안한다. 사용자와 서비스 제공자 간의 거래를 위한 오프체인 채널을 연 후 채널 상에서 실시간으로 비용을 지불하고 비디오를 스트리밍 받는 시스템을 설계하였다. 이러한 실시간 스트리밍 방식을 통해 기존 블록체인 서비스의 단점을 극복하였다.

  • PDF

블록체인 기반 시스템의 구조적 분석과 취약점 도출 (Structural Analysis and Derivation of Vulnerability for BlockChain based System)

  • 김장환
    • 한국소프트웨어감정평가학회 논문지
    • /
    • 제15권1호
    • /
    • pp.115-121
    • /
    • 2019
  • 지속적으로 확산되어져 가고 있는 블록체인 시스템과 블록체인 기반의 서비스 시스템의 구조를 분석하였다. 거래 쌍방 간의 신뢰 확보를 위한 제 3 자를 필요로 하지 않는, 분산화된 장부 암호화 시스템 소프트웨어 기술이다. 블록체인은 자료 구조적으로는 링크드 리스트 구조로 되어 있다. 블록체인은 거래 정보를 블록화 하여 다른 블록들과 연결해서 거래 정보를 관리한다. 해시 함수를 사용하여 블록화와 연결을 하게 된다. 결과적으로, 현재의 블록체인 시스템과 블록체인 기반의 서비스 시스템의 구조적 취약성을 발견하였다. 본 논문에서 제시한 블록체인 시스템과 블록체인 기반의 서비스 시스템의 구조적인 문제점 등이 해결되어지게 되면, 다양한 산업적 기여가 예상된다.

블록체인을 이용한 부동산종합공부시스템 참조모델 (A Reference Model for Korea Real Estate Administration Intelligence System Using Block Chain)

  • 선종철;김진욱
    • 정보처리학회논문지:컴퓨터 및 통신 시스템
    • /
    • 제7권11호
    • /
    • pp.281-288
    • /
    • 2018
  • 동일한 데이터를 여러 곳에 보관하는 분산원장을 특징으로 갖는 블록체인은 보안성과 안정성을 비롯한 여러 가지 기술적 특징을 가지며, 이로 인해 블록체인의 활용처에 관한 연구가 다양하게 이루어지고 있다. 본 논문에서는 공적장부의 하나인 부동산종합공부시스템에 블록체인을 적용하기 위해 고려할 사항들을 도출하고, 이를 바탕으로 블록체인 시스템 구성 방안과 합의 알고리즘을 포함하는 블록체인 참조 모델을 제시한다.

블록체인 기반 미디어사물인터넷 카메라 스트리밍 시스템 (Internet of media things camera streaming system based on blockchain)

  • 정민혁;김상균
    • 한국방송∙미디어공학회:학술대회논문집
    • /
    • 한국방송∙미디어공학회 2019년도 하계학술대회
    • /
    • pp.288-290
    • /
    • 2019
  • 본 논문에서는 블록체인 및 암호화폐(토큰)를 이용해 미디어사물인터넷 내 카메라로부터의 비디오 스트리밍 서비스를 제공하는 시스템을 제안한다. 사용자가 분산형 애플리케이션을 통해 블록체인 상에 작성되어 있는 스마트 컨트랙트의 계약조건에 따라 토큰을 지불하고, 토큰을 지불 받은 IP 카메라는 촬영하고 있는 동영상을 실시간으로 사용자에게 스트리밍하는 시나리오를 구성하였다. 블록체인 카메라 스트리밍 서비스의 가능성을 알아보기 위해, 이더리움 기반의 블록체인 위에 스트리밍 서비스를 위한 스마트 컨트랙트를 업로드하고, 거래에 필요한 ERC20 토큰을 제작하여 시스템을 구현하였다.

  • PDF

블록체인 시스템에서의 프라이버시 보호 기술 동향 분석 (Analysis of Privacy Protection Technology Trends in Blockchain Systems)

  • 이태혁;강명조;김미희
    • 한국정보처리학회:학술대회논문집
    • /
    • 한국정보처리학회 2022년도 추계학술발표대회
    • /
    • pp.82-84
    • /
    • 2022
  • 최초 블록체인 시스템 비트코인이 나온 이후 현재 이를 활용한 다양한 기술들이 나오고 있다. 블록체인은 탈중앙성, 무결성, 보안성, 투명성 등 여러 가지 특성들을 가지고 있다. 블록체인의 투명성은 블록체인의 모든 데이터가 모두에게 공개된다는 특징으로 많은 관심을 가졌으나 이러한 특징은 블록체인이 실생활 도입의 활용도를 낮추고 있는 추세이다. 그래서 이를 보완하기 위해서 블록체인 시스템에서 프라이버시 보호 기술들 즉, 링서명, 영지식 증명, 프라이빗 샌드 등을 활용한 다양한 프로토콜이 등장하고 있다. 이에 본 논문에서는 이러한 기술들의 특징과 장단점을 분석하고자 한다.

머신러닝 기법을 활용한 블록체인의 엉클블록 분석 연구 (A Study on Uncle Block Analysis of Blockchain Using Machine Learning Techniques)

  • 김한민
    • 경영정보학연구
    • /
    • 제22권1호
    • /
    • pp.1-16
    • /
    • 2020
  • 블록체인은 시스템에 참여하는 사용자들 사이에 믿음을 확보할 수 있는 기술로 떠오르고 있다. 블록체인에 대한 관심이 높아지면서 선행 연구들은 블록체인 기술에 관련된 암호화폐와 적용방안에 대한 연구를 주로 수행하였다. 반면에 블록체인의 안정적인 구동에 대한 연구는 크게 주목하지 않았다. 대표적으로 블록체인의 엉클블록은 블록체인 시스템의 안정적 구동에 중요한 역할을 담당함에도 불구하고 이에 대한 연구는 거의 수행되지 않았다. 이러한 인식을 기반으로 본 연구는 블록체인 정보와 거시 경제 요인들을 활용하여 블록체인의 엉클블록을 머신러닝 기법으로 예측하고자 하였다. 인공신경망, 서포트벡터머신 분석 결과, 블록체인 정보와 거시 경제 요인들은 블록체인의 엉클블록 예측에 기여하는 것으로 나타났다. 또한, 블록체인 정보만을 활용한 인공신경망은 엉클블록의 발생을 예측하는데 가장 우수한 성능을 제공하는 것으로 나타났다. 본 연구는 정보시스템 분야에서 블록체인 연구를 주도하고 기여할 수 있는 방안을 제시한다.

부동산종합공부시스템에서의 블록체인 연계방안 연구 (A Study on Linkage of Block Chain in Korea Real Estate Administration Intelligence System)

  • 선종철;김진욱
    • 한국정보처리학회:학술대회논문집
    • /
    • 한국정보처리학회 2018년도 춘계학술발표대회
    • /
    • pp.113-116
    • /
    • 2018
  • 동일한 데이터를 여러 곳에 보관하는 분산원장을 특징으로 갖는 블록체인은 보안성과 안정성을 비롯한 여러 가지 기술적 특징을 가지며, 이로 인해 블록체인의 활용처에 대한 연구가 다양하게 이루어지고 있다. 본 논문에서는 공적장부의 하나인 부동산종합공부시스템에 블록체인을 적용하기 위해 고려할 사항들을 도출하고, 이를 바탕으로 블록체인 시스템 구성 방안과 합의 알고리즘 참조모형을 제시한다.

Go 언어 기반 블록체인 코드의 품질 검증을 위한 효율적인 정적분석기 개발 (Constructing Effective Code Analyzer to Measure the Quality of Blockchain Code based on Go Language)

  • 안현식;박지훈;박보경;김영철
    • 한국정보처리학회:학술대회논문집
    • /
    • 한국정보처리학회 2019년도 추계학술발표대회
    • /
    • pp.694-696
    • /
    • 2019
  • 현재 4차 산업 혁명과 가상화폐에 대한 전 세계적인 관심으로 블록체인 시스템이 급부상하고 있다. 현재 구현중심인 국내외 블록체인 시장에서 무수히 많은 블록체인 기반 플랫폼들이 등장과 함께 오류가 발생하고 있다. 하지만 블록체인 시스템의 신뢰성, 확장성, 안정성 등에 대한 검증은 누구도 하고 있지 않다. 이런 문제 해결을 위해 Go language로 구성된 블록체인 코드를 분석할 수 있는 정적분석기를 통한 품질 가시화 방법을 제안한다. 이를 통하여 Blockchain Code의 내부 복잡도를 식별하고자한다. 즉, 코드 내부를 가시화하고 개발자가 보다 쉽게 코드를 유지보수 할 수 있으며 블록체인 시스템의 소프트웨어 공학적인 고품질화가 가능하다.

블록체인을 활용한 전자거래 시스템 (Electronic transaction system using blockchain)

  • 권봉재;최민
    • 한국정보처리학회:학술대회논문집
    • /
    • 한국정보처리학회 2019년도 추계학술발표대회
    • /
    • pp.723-725
    • /
    • 2019
  • 이 시스템은 미래 혁신 기술로 각광받고 있는 블록체인 기술의 특징을 이용하여 사용자들의 거래 내역을 블록화 하여 보안성을 강화하고 결재정보나 개인정보를 보호해서 안정성을 추구하며 블록체인에서 구현하기 어려운 결제의 불완전성을 극복하려는 시스템이다. 본 논문에서는 이러한 시스템을 설계한 과정 중에 일부분인 블록체인의 유효성검사, 블록 저장한 화면들을 보여주고 설명하고 있다.

블록체인을 연계한 ESS 공정거래 시스템 개발 (Development of ESS Fair Trade System Linked with Blockchain )

  • 김건일;정양권;김용식;김진석
    • 한국전자통신학회논문지
    • /
    • 제18권1호
    • /
    • pp.149-156
    • /
    • 2023
  • 본 연구는 에너지 참여형 소비자를 위한 블록체인과 연계한 ESS 전력거래 시스템을 개발하고자 하였다. 신재생에너지 ESS 전력량 및 수요정보를 공개할 목적으로 블록체인 DB에 스마트 컨트랙트 시스템을 구축하고 에너지 프로슈머와 컨슈머의 블록체인 DB 데이터를 활용하여 전력거래시장의 유연한 확대를 위한 현실적인 솔루션을 제공할 수 있도록 하였다. 따라서, 블록체인과 연계한 ESS 전력거래 시스템을 개발하는데 주요 내용으로 ESS 관리를 위한 클라우드 기반 WEB 구축, 블록체인 활성화를 위한 코인 발행 및 거래소 등록, 블록체인 기술을 반영하기 위한 전자지갑 생성, ESS 기반 생산 수요 자료수집 및 공급과 관련한 블록체인 데이터베이스 구축, 블록체인 기반 플랫폼 선정 및 기반 구축, 스마트 컨트랙트 제작 등을 고려하여 구현하였다.